Research Project:
The USDA-ARS Food Science & Market Quality and Handling Research Unit investigates technologies for vegetable pickling and fermentation under Program 306. The selected candidate will work microbial roles in texture loss during processing and storage, performing microscopy with a Keyence Imaging System, enzyme kinetic assays, bioinformatic analyses, and texture measurements. You will collect and analyze data, and help develop SOPs for advanced microscopy.

Learning Objectives:
Acquire foundational lab skills, mastery of microscopy and microbial enzyme assays, food texture measurement techniques, and bioinformatics tools for microbial genomics.
